ag•o•ny
Pronunciation: (ag'u-nē), [key]—
n.,
—pl. -nies.
1. extreme and generally prolonged pain; intense physical or mental suffering.
2. a display or outburst of intense mental or emotional excitement:
an agony of joy.
3. the struggle preceding natural death:
mortal agony.
4. a violent struggle.
5. (often cap.) Theol.the sufferings of Christ in the garden of Gethsemane.
